How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Montclair?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Montclair Studio Apartments | $2,127 | $1,595 | $2,727 |
| Montclair 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,212 | $1,469 | $3,110 |
| Montclair 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,649 | $1,600 | $3,815 |
| Montclair 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,454 | $2,500 | $4,005 |
| Montclair 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,544 | $2,700 | $3,976 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Montclair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Montclair with 2 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in Montclair is at Villa Serena Senior Apartments listed at $1,650.
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Montclair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Montclair is $2,649.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Montclair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Montclair is a 1,364 square feet unit starting from $3,815 at Village at Montclair.
What is the average size for Montclair 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in Montclair is currently 1,044 sq ft.
